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Safety processing method based on application programming, intelligent terminal and storage medium

A technology for secure processing and application programming, applied in the field of computer applications, which can solve problems affecting development efficiency, etc.

Inactive Publication Date: 2019-06-21
北京智游网安科技有限公司
View PDF4 Cites 2 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0003] In order to avoid the above risks, in the process of developing APP, you can add macro definitions to class and method names to achieve the effect of modifying class names and method names at compile time, but this method needs to add macro definitions for all classes and methods one by one. , affecting development efficiency during project development

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Safety processing method based on application programming, intelligent terminal and storage medium
  • Safety processing method based on application programming, intelligent terminal and storage medium
  • Safety processing method based on application programming, intelligent terminal and storage medium

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0036] In order to make the object, technical solution and advantages of the present invention more clear and definite, the present invention will be further described in detail below with reference to the accompanying drawings and examples. It should be understood that the specific embodiments described here are only used to explain the present invention, not to limit the present invention.

[0037] The security processing method based on application programming described in the preferred embodiment of the present invention, such as figure 1 As shown, the security processing method based on application programming includes the following steps:

[0038] Step S10, obtaining and parsing the executable file, reading the header information in the executable file, and reading the index information about the locations of different regions.

[0039] Please refer to the specific process figure 2 , which is a flowchart of step S10 in the security processing method based on applicati...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ention discloses a security processing method based on application programming, an intelligent terminal and a storage medium, and the method comprises the steps: obtaining and analyzing an executable file, reading header information in the executable file, and reading index information about positions where different regions are located; reading the data area according to the index information of the positions of different areas, and reading values corresponding to the index areas of the class-related information in the data area; reading basic information of one class, and reading indexes of all method names contained in the class according to the basic information; searching the class names and the method names from the character string table according to the indexes of the classnames and the method names, and modifying the class names and the method names according to a preset rule. Through the class names and the method names, original English which is meaningful and convenient to check is changed into unmeaningful English or relatively random character combinations, so that crackers are not easy to guess functions corresponding to the classes, and the safety of the APPis improved on the premise that the working efficiency of the APP developers is kept.

Description

technical field [0001] The present invention relates to the technical field of computer applications, in particular to a security processing method based on application programming, an intelligent terminal and a storage medium. Background technique [0002] At present, data security issues are getting more and more attention. The cracking of iOS APP will cause data leakage, and valuable technology will be stolen by competitors, which may cause large commercial losses. In order to crack the iOS APP, crackers can analyze the iOS APP through static analysis (analyze according to the characteristics of the file when the APP is not running) and dynamic analysis (analyze when the APP is running). In the process of analyzing the code, it is often through the class name and method name (the class name and method name are the names determined according to the functional characteristics when writing the APP program. There are multiple methods in a class, and the class name and method ...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(China)
IPC IPC(8): G06F8/41
Inventor 张天水廖兴龙
Owner 北京智游网安科技有限公司
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products